Transaction 12821816559debb8ccf587fbc83be3efb8d879adf41bbfe8ed7e0abf3034986f
1 Input
1 Output
-
12821816559debb8ccf587fbc83be3efb8d879adf41bbfe8ed7e0abf3034986f:0
- value
- 385674
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f144398e8863bc867da417778be779146263940
- address
- bc1q3u2y8x8gscause76g9mh30nhj9rzvw2qh72a2j